This role will be working in the UK finance team, assisting the Management Accountant with various functions within the Sales Ledger. This role will be working in the UK finance team, assisting the Management Accountant with various functions within the Sales Ledger.
As an Accounts Payable Specialist, your responsibility will be to:
- Uploading of new customers into Navision, including the appropriate credit checks, international and banking compliance checks on all new customers, and request credit limits from the bank.
- Banking of all incoming customer cash into the circa 30+ bank accounts
- Assist Management Accountant with setting up of all payments (GBP/EUR/USD/SGD)
- Weekly production of the aged debt analysis for line manager
- Chasing outstanding debts in a timely manner
- Improve and implement debt collection processes when there are any overdue invoices or payments and escalate any bad debts to the line manager.
- Assist with maintaining all aspects of the Invoice Finance facility (reporting, monthly reconciliations, annual audit & queries)
- Working with the Management Accountant for the reporting of any overdue debt to HSBC to ensure that our credit protection is maintained in the event of a customer defaulting
- Approving requests to release orders.
